(Area) A Minnesota man faces numerous charges following a pursuit through southwest Iowa. Iowa State Patrol Trooper and District #4 Public Information Officer Shelby McCreedy says a trooper attempted a traffic stop on a semi driven by 38-year old Jeremy Samstead of St. James, Minnesota, at around 7:08 a.m. on westbound Interstate 80 near the 75-mile marker.
McCreedy says law enforcement deployed stop sticks which eventually disabled the semi.
Authorities transported Samstead to the Adair County Jail. He is charged with; eluding, speeding, stop sign violation, no electronic logbook, and driving while revoked. Additionally, Samstead has warrants out of Iowa, Minnesota, Missouri, and Wisconsin.
The agencies involved in the incident include; the Iowa State Patrol, Cass County Sheriff Office, Shelby County Sheriff’s Office, Pottawattamie County Sheriff’s Office, and Iowa Motor vehicle Enforcement.
